Shape characteristics of box-type resistance furnace and precautions for use

Shape characteristics of box-type resistance furnace and precautions for use

The front panel and bottom corner of the box-type resistance furnace are made of cast iron, and the outer shell is made of cold plates. The appearance is flat, beautiful and not deformed. The furnace door is fixed on the box body through multi-stage hinges. The furnace door is locked by the weight of the door handle, and the furnace door is fastened on the furnace mouth through leverage. When opening, you only need to lift the handle up, and pull it out to the left side of the box-type resistance furnace after the hook lock is unhooked. The furnace shell of the electric furnace is made of thin steel plate by hemming welding, epoxy powder electrostatic spray paint process, the inner furnace lining is a rectangular integral furnace lining made of silicon refractory; the furnace door brick is made of light refractory material, and the inner furnace lining is between the furnace shell The insulation layer is made of refractory fiber products. The lining is a sealed structure. The furnace core can be drawn out from the small door behind the furnace, which is easier to maintain than other similar furnaces; the lower end of the furnace mouth is equipped with a safety switch interlocking with the furnace door. When the furnace door is opened, the heating circuit is automatically cut off, and the door is automatically powered off to ensure Safe operation.

A. The working environment of box-type resistance furnace requires no flammable materials and corrosive gases.

B. When you first use it or use it again after a long period of inactivity, you should first oven it, the temperature is 200 ~ 600 ℃, and the time is about 4 hours.

C. When using box-type resistance furnace, the furnace temperature shall not exceed the higher furnace temperature, and do not work above the rated temperature for a long time.

D. When using box-type resistance furnace, the furnace door should be closed and opened slightly to prevent damage to the parts.

E. To ensure safe use, a ground wire must be installed and well grounded.

F. When placing samples in the furnace chamber of the box-type resistance furnace, turn off the power first, and handle it gently to ensure safety and avoid damage to the furnace chamber.

g. In order to extend the service life of the box-type resistance furnace and ensure safety, samples should be taken out of the furnace in time after the equipment is used, withdraw from the heating and turn off the power supply.
